- 博客(19)
- 收藏
- 关注
原创 学习学习学习
学习渠道1、战略形态(阵地战/侧翼战/游击战/防御战)2、渠道选择3、渠道模式4、招商策划项目的生命周期立项阶段项目启动发展成熟完成阶段阶段特点TCP/IP协议簇路由交换技术MAC地址表ARP表路由表AP路由器交换机防火墙渠道1、战略形态(阵地战/侧翼战/游击战/防御战)01、渠道的本质的价值和利益的分配02、渠道问题某种意义上是一个“政治体制”问题。(因为她涉及愿景的追随和信赖03、利益结构的设计和分配,严格的管理和奖惩,对营销组织的动员和控制2、渠道选择01、渠道之战不过奇正,奇正之变,不
2022-02-05 19:22:21
559
原创 Swagger学习
Swagger学习目标:了解Swagger的作用和概念了解前后端分离在SpringBoot中集成SwaggerSwagger简介前后端分离Vue+SpringBoot后端时代:前端只用管理静态页面;html==>后端。模板引擎 Jsp=>后端是主力前后端分离时代:后端:后端控制层,服务层,数据访问层【后端团队】前端:前端控制层,视图层【前端团队】。伪造后端数据,json。已经存在了,不需要后端,前端工程依旧能够跑起来前后端如何交互?===>API
2021-10-02 20:18:55
139
原创 File类、递归
File类概述java.io.File类是文件和目录路径名的抽象表示,主要用于文件和目录的创建、查找和删除等操作。我们可以使用File类的方法创建一个文件/文件夹删除文件/文件夹获取文件/文件夹判断文件/文件夹是否存在对文件夹进行遍历获取文件的大小File类是一个与系统无关的类,任何的操作系统都可以使用这个类中的方法重点:记住这三个单词file:文件directory:文件夹/目录path:路径File类的静态成员变量static String pathSeparator 与
2020-10-11 23:34:54
168
原创 等待与唤醒案例、线程池、Lambda表达式
等待唤醒机制线程间通信概念:多个线程在处理同一个资源,但是处理的动作(线程的任务)却不相同等待于唤醒机制:线程之间的通信重点:有效的利用资源(生产一个包子,吃一个包子,再生成一个,在吃一个)等待唤醒中的方法等待唤醒机制就是用于解决线程间通信的问题的,使用到的3个方法的含义如下:wait:线程不再活动,不再参与调度,进入 wait set 中,因此不会浪费 CPU 资源,也不会去竞争锁了,这时的线程状态即是 WAITING。它还要等着别的线程执行一个特别的动作,也即是“通知(notify)
2020-08-30 01:54:20
122
原创 线程、同步
线程多线程原理随机打印结果多线程内存图解Thread类的常用方法获取线程名称的方法获取线程的名称:1.使用Thread类中的方法getName()String getName() 返回该线程的名称。2.可以先获取到当前正在执行的线程,使用线程中的方法getName()获取线程的名称static Thread currentThread() 返回对当前正在执行的线程对象的引用。定义一个Thread类的子类public class MyThread extends Thread{
2020-08-24 15:12:05
117
原创 异常,线程
异常概念&异常体系异常:指的是程序正在执行过程中,出现的非正常的情况,最终会导致JVM的非正常停止。异常体系:Throwable体系:Error:严重错误Error,无法通过处理的错误,只能事先避免,好比绝症。Exception:表示异常,异常产生后程序员可以通过代码的方式纠正,使程序员继续运行,是必须要处理的。好比感冒。异常分类java.lang.Throwable:类是 Java 语言中所有错误或异常的超类。Exception:编译期异常,进行编译(写代码)java程序出现的问题
2020-08-18 19:56:59
133
原创 Map,斗地主案例
Mapjava.util.Map<k,v>集合Map集合的特点:1.Map集合是一个双列集合,一个元素包含两个值(一个key,一个value)2.Map集合中的元素,key和value的数据类型可以相同,也可以不同3.Map集合中的元素,key是不允许重复的,value是可以重复的4.Map集合中的元素,key和value是一一对应...
2020-08-18 00:30:45
133
原创 Collection集合
Collection集合集合框架介绍集合框架介绍学习集合的目标:1.会使用集合存储数据2.会遍历集合,把数据取出来3.掌握每种集合的特性
2020-08-07 23:24:45
254
1
原创 Object类、Date类、Calendar类、System类。。。
ObjectObject类的toString方法equals方法Object类的toString方法toString方法默认打印的就是对象的地址值没有意义,我们就要重写toString方法,可以自动生成:@Override public String toString() { return "Person{" + "name='" + name + '\'' + ", age=" + age +
2020-08-04 13:59:57
211
原创 final关键字、权限、内部类
finalfinal关键字概念与四种用法final用来修饰类final用来修饰成员方法final关键字概念与四种用法final关键字代表最终、不可改变的。常见四种用法:可以用来修饰一个类可以用来修饰一个方法还可以用来修饰一个局部变量还可以用来修饰一个成员变量final用来修饰类当final关键字用来修饰一个类的时候,格式:public final class 类名称 {// …}含义:当前这个类不能有任何的子类。(太监类)注意:一个类如果是final的,那么其中所有的成员方法
2020-07-24 18:39:34
292
原创 接口、多态
接口接口的概述接口的定义基本格式接口的抽象方法定义接口的抽象方法使用接口的默认方法定义接口的默认方法使用接口的静态方法定义接口的静态方法使用接口的私有方法定义接口的私有方法使用接口的概述接口就是一种公共的规范标准只要符号规范标准,就可以大家使用接口的定义基本格式接口就是多个类的公共规范。接口是一种引用数据类型,最重要的内容就是其中的:抽象方法。如何定义一个接口的格式:public interface 接口名称 {// 接口内容}备注:换成了关键字interface之后,编译生成的字节
2020-07-18 20:10:40
115
原创 继承和抽象
继承继承的概述继承的格式继承中成员变量的访问特点区分子类方法中重名的三种变量继承中成员方法的访问特点继承中方法的覆盖重写-概念与特点继承中方法的覆盖重写-注意事项继承中方法的覆盖重写-应用场景继承中构造方法的访问特点super关键字的三种用法this关键字的三种用法super和this关键字图解继承的概述继承的格式在继承的关系中,“子类就是一个父类”。也就是说,子类可以被当做父类看待。例如父类是员工,子类是讲师,那么“讲师就是一个员工”。关系:is-a定义父类的格式:(一个普通的类定义)pub
2020-07-13 19:05:59
464
原创 字符串
字符串字符串概述和特点字符串概述和特点java.lang.String类代表字符串。API当中说:Java 程序中的所有字符串字面值(如 “abc” )都作为此类的实例实现。其实就是说:程序当中所有的双引号字符串,都是String类的对象。(就算没有new,也照样是。)字符串的特点:字符串的内容永不可变。【重点】正是因为字符串不可改变,所以字符串是可以共享使用的。字符串效果上相当于是char[]字符数组,但是底层原理是byte[]字节数组。创建字符串的常见3+1种方式。三种构造方法:
2020-07-12 16:45:03
194
原创 面向对象
面向对象面向对象思想的概述面向对象思想的举例类和对象的关系什么是类:什么是对象对象的创建及其使用面向对象思想的概述面向过程:当需要实现一个功能的时候,每一个具体的步骤都要亲力亲为,详细处理每一个细节。面向对象:当需要实现一个功能的时候,不关心具体的步骤,而是找一个已经具有该功能的人,来帮我做事儿。import java.util.Arrays;public class Demo01PrintArray { public static void main(String[] args)
2020-07-10 18:09:45
238
原创 使用IDEA进行学习
使用IDEA进行学习idea的常用快捷键方法的三种调用格式idea的常用快捷键Alt+Enter 导入包 自动修正代码Ctrl+Y 删除光标所在行Ctrl+D 复制光标所在行Ctrl+Alt+L 格式化代码Ctrl+/ 单行注释,再按取消注释Ctrl+Shift+/ 多行注释,再按取消注释方法的三种调用格式方法其实就是若干语句的功能集合。方法好比是一个工厂。蒙牛工厂 原料:奶牛、饲料、水产出物:奶制品钢铁工
2020-07-07 20:20:28
347
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人